Haiti - Education : Presentation of the skills profile of professionals in health sciences

On December 10 at the Montana Hotel, as part of the efforts of the Ministry of Public Health and Population (MSPP), to improve the quality of health care and services, Marie Gréta Roy Clément, Minister Health through its Health Sciences Training and Development Department, in the presence of, among others, Pierre Josué Agénor Cadet, the Minister of National Education formally presented the competency profile of professionals in Health Sciences.

For Minister Clément, the main objective is to achieve "an alignment of our different training institutions around a body of expertise adapted to the epidemiological profile of the country and the essential package of services defined by the Ministry of Public Health and Population, while meeting international requirements."

Minister Cadet welcomed this progress, which is in line with the progress already made in the education sector, which has a National Training Plan for Education Personnel presenting the entry and exit profiles for each category of staff. He stressed that this document "becomes the frame of reference for all categories of professionals in the health sciences" adding "it represents a major step in the regulation of the sector and for the professionalization of health staff. It will provide clear guidance for the development of human resource management strategies and the development of training programs as well as the formative supervision of the health professional."

Cadet expressed confidence that with the publication and dissemination of this document, the Ministry of Health and its partners will be able to continue to improve the quality of health care provision to the population, while waiting for the upcoming vote of the national budget to allocate sufficient financial resources for its proper execution.
